What is a 150 000 job?

'150 000' is not a specific job title, but rather appears to reference a salary amount (150,000), which could apply to many different professions across various industries. Jobs that offer a salary of 150,000 dollars or more typically require significant experience, advanced education, or specialized skills. Examples of such roles include senior software engineers, physicians, lawyers, and executives. What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a financial analyst,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Financial Analyst, you need strong analytical abilities, financial modeling skills, and a solid understanding of accounting principles, typically supported by a bachelor’s degree in finance or a related field. Proficiency with Excel, financial analysis software, and often certifications like the CFA are highly valued. Excellent communication, attention to detail, and problem-solving skills help analysts present insights and collaborate effectively. These qualities are critical for providing accurate financial recommendations that guide business decisions.

Lead the Future of Interventional Neurology in Iowa

MercyOne (https://www.mercyone.org/about-us) is seeking an experienced, fellowship-trained Interventional Neurologist to join our leading and growing practice in Des Moines, IA. This role offers the opportunity to expand our IV neurology service line within a collaborative team, supported by a strong referral network serving a population of 1.4 million. The ideal candidate brings strong clinical expertise and a passion for program growth, thriving in a collaborative, team environment.

Job Opportunity Details

  • Join a team of 12 Physicians and 4 APPs

  • Thrombectomy call coverage 1:3

  • Over 1000 annual stroke cases

  • 160+ annual Thrombectomies

  • Building a new and dedicated Neuro IR Suite

  • Onsite support: dedicated Neurohospitalists, Neurosurgery

  • Opportunity for elective aneurysm cases

  • Opportunity to teach residents and medical students

Why this Opportunity?

MercyOne Ruan Neurology is an integrated multispecialty practice with a statewide referral network. Our team of 12 neurologists and 4 advanced practice providers manages the full spectrum of neurological conditions across all subspecialties. We are a Joint Commission-certified Advanced Thrombectomy Capable Stroke Center and opportunities exist for outreach and tele-neurology services. Our comprehensive practice collaborates closely with Neurosurgery, Neuropsychology,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ation, and Pain Medicine. MercyOne Ruan Neurology also serves as faculty for MercyOne residents (Family Medicine, Psychiatry, and Internal Medicine) and Des Moines University medical students.
